Water Damage Reconstruction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under the sink Yes No You can fix it yourself with a wrench and some plumbing tape.
Large flood in your basement No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to dry and restore your home.
Musty odors in your attic No Yes You’ll need to identify and address the source of the moisture, which may need specialized equipment and expertise.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es You’ll need to assess the extent of the damage and develop a plan to repair or replace the affected flooring.
Discoloration on walls or ceilings No Yes You’ll need to identify the source of the discoloration and develop a plan to repair or replace the affected area.
Water stains on ceilings or walls No Yes You’ll need to assess the extent of the damage and develop a plan to repair or replace the affected area.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ost in Lehi, UT

The cost of water damage reconstruction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lehi, UT. Here are some estimated price ranges: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ed
Repair and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ed
Final Inspection and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ates for the work we’ll do.
